The Australian Butterfly Sanctuary in Kuranda is the largest butterfly flight aviary in Australia, home to over 1,200 tropical butterflies. Visitors can stroll through boardwalks and gardens while these colorful creatures flutter around them. The sanctuary offers behind-the-scenes tours, educational exhibits, and a chance to see butterflies up close in their natural habitat. It's a magical experience for all ages, with plenty of photo opportunities and a peaceful atmosphere to enjoy.
